What’s the Difference Between Hemp Protein and Whey Protein?
Whey protein wins on muscle-building efficiency and cost-per-gram of protein. Hemp protein wins on dietary fibre, omega-3 ALA, and compatibility with dairy-free or plant-based diets. The right pick depends on whether your priority is maximum protein density or whole-food nutrition with allergy-friendly credentials.
Hemp protein is a plant based protein powder milled from cold-pressed hemp seeds of the hemp plant (Cannabis sativa), where hemp seed oil is first extracted and the remaining material is processed into a fine powder, delivering roughly 30–50% protein by weight and serving as a complete protein source built primarily from edestin and albumin, two highly bioavailable storage proteins.
Whey protein is a dairy-derived protein isolated as a byproduct of cheese production and other dairy products. It comes in three main forms: whey protein concentrate (~70–80% protein), isolate (~90% protein), and hydrolysate (pre-digested for faster absorption).
| Factor | Hemp Protein | Whey Protein (Isolate) |
| Protein per 30 g scoop | 10–15 grams of protein per serving | 25–27 grams of protein per serving |
| Fiber | 8–12 g | 0–1 g |
| Carbs | 2–4 g | 1–2 g |
| Amino acid completeness | Complete, low in lysine and leucine | Complete, leucine-rich |
| Absorption speed | Slow (fiber-bound) | Fast (20–40 min) |
| Avg. price per gram of protein | $0.08–0.15 | $0.03–0.05 |
| Best suited for | Vegans, gut health, satiety | Hypertrophy, recovery, macro tracking |
Hemp protein is naturally lactose-free, gluten-free, and soy-free, which makes it the default alternative for anyone managing dairy allergies, lactose intolerance, or celiac disease. Whey, by contrast, remains the benchmark for protein density and sits at nearly every supplement retailer at a lower price point.
Protein Quality: Amino Acids, Leucine, and Muscle Building
Both whey protein and hemp protein qualify as complete proteins because they contain all nine essential amino acids required by the human body, forming a complete amino acid profile similar to most animal proteins. The critical difference lies in quantity: hemp carries relatively low levels of lysine and leucine, the two amino acids most tightly linked to muscle-protein synthesis (MPS).
Protein quality scores make the gap visible. On the PDCAAS scale, whey protein hits ~1.00, the maximum possible score, while hemp protein lands between 0.46 and 0.63 depending on processing and fiber content. The newer DIAAS scale tells the same story, with whey scoring near 1.09 and hemp closer to 0.50.
Leucine density is where the difference becomes practical. A 25 g scoop of whey isolate typically delivers 2.5–3 g of leucine, clearing the ~2.5 g threshold sports nutrition researchers associate with maximal MPS activation. An equivalent hemp serving usually provides under 1 g of leucine, well below that trigger point needed to support muscle protein synthesis.
Combined with whey protein powder’s faster absorption of roughly 20–40 minutes, this leucine density is why whey remains the default choice for hypertrophy, post-workout recovery, and muscle growth in bodybuilding programs built around repeated MPS spikes.
That said, hemp is not disqualified from muscle support. Total daily protein intake matters more than any single serving, and lifters who hit 1.6–2.2 g/kg of bodyweight can maintain and build muscle on plant proteins.
The practical fix for hemp users: take larger scoops (40–50 g) or blend hemp with pea protein or rice protein to round out the lysine and leucine profile closer to whey’s amino acid delivery.

Hemp Protein vs Whey Isolate: The Closest Head-to-Head
Whey isolate is whey concentrate pushed through an additional filtration stage, either microfiltration or ion-exchange, until the powder reaches roughly 90% protein by weight. This extra step strips out nearly all lactose, fat, and residual carbohydrates, leaving a lean, almost pure protein product.
The protein gap per scoop is where the two products separate most sharply. A 30 g scoop of whey isolate delivers around 25–27 g of protein, while a 30 g scoop of hemp protein lands at only 10–15 g because hemp retains its natural fiber and fat fraction. In practice, you need close to two scoops of hemp to match one scoop of isolate.
That density gap drives the cost equation. Whey isolate typically costs $0.03–0.05 per gram of protein, whereas hemp protein runs $0.08–0.15 per gram, making hemp 2–3x more expensive when measured by actual protein delivered rather than by bag weight.
The lactose argument also narrows against isolate specifically. Because isolate contains under 1 g of lactose per serving, many mildly lactose-intolerant users digest it comfortably, which shrinks hemp’s dairy-free edge to users with true allergies, casein sensitivity, or strict plant-based diets.
The verdict is clean. Choose whey isolate for maximum protein efficiency, tight macros, and the lowest cost per gram. Choose hemp protein when you need a fully plant-based source, react to trace dairy, or want the fiber and omega-3 ALA that isolate simply doesn’t provide.
Digestibility, Fiber, and Dietary Restrictions
Beyond amino acids and cost, digestion shapes which powder actually works for your body. Whey protein absorbs in roughly 20–40 minutes, which is why sports nutritionists classify it as a fast protein and recommend it for the post-workout anabolic window. Hemp protein digests more slowly because its fiber matrix delays gastric emptying, making it behave closer to a light meal-replacement shake than a rapid recovery drink, unlike whey protein.
That dietary fibre content is substantial: around 8–12 g per 30 g serving. For gut health, satiety, and heart health, this is a genuine advantage, feeding beneficial microbiota and prolonging fullness. The downside is the “pass-through” effect users often report on forums like Reddit, where coarser hemp fiber exits largely undigested if the powder is poorly milled or taken in oversized scoops.
Hemp’s protein fraction itself is well tolerated. Roughly 65% edestin (a globular storage protein structurally similar to human blood plasma proteins) and about 35% albumin support digestive health and give hemp a gentler digestive profile than soy. Still, the accompanying raw fiber can trigger bloating in sensitive stomachs, so gradual introduction helps.
Whey has its own digestive caveats. Lactose residues in concentrate frequently cause bloating, gas, or diarrhea in lactose-intolerant users. Whey isolate and hydrolysate remove most of the lactose and resolve these symptoms for most users.
Dietary fit is where the split becomes obvious. Hemp protein suits vegan, dairy-free, soy-free, gluten-free, and kosher dietary requirements, along with most allergy-sensitive eaters. Whey fits omnivores without lactose issues who prioritize maximum protein density per scoop.
Hemp Protein vs Whey Protein for Weight Loss
For appetite control, hemp protein holds the advantage; for strict macro tracking, whey isolate wins. The best pick depends on which obstacle is actually stalling your fat loss.
Hemp protein delivers 8–12 g of fiber per 30 g scoop alongside its protein, which slows gastric emptying and extends fullness well past whey’s 20–40 minute absorption window. That sustained satiety helps reduce unplanned snacking, often the real driver of weight regain.
Whey isolate answers back with leaner macros: roughly 100–110 kcal per 30 g scoop with minimal fat and carbs, versus hemp’s 110–130 kcal with added fiber and higher fat content. Whey also carries a stronger thermic effect per gram and has clinical research linking it to better lean muscle mass preservation during a caloric deficit, which protects resting metabolic rate.
Hemp still brings metabolic benefits worth counting. Its natural omega-3 ALA and other healthy fats support cardiovascular and metabolic health, and unflavored hemp triggers a lower insulin response than many sweetened whey blends loaded with maltodextrin or sucralose.
The practical verdict: choose whey isolate if you’re measuring every gram and chasing maximum protein-per-calorie, and choose hemp if hunger between meals is the reason your deficit keeps breaking.
Many users simply rotate both, taking whey protein powder after training for fast recovery and using a fiber-rich hemp protein powder at breakfast or as an afternoon snack for lasting fullness.
Flavor, Price, and Availability: What Buyers Actually Report
Taste and cost often decide which powder survives past the first tub. Hemp protein carries a distinct nutty, earthy, slightly grassy flavor that catches many first-time users off guard, especially when mixed with plain water. Whey blends, by contrast, are engineered for palatability and often include artificial sweeteners, coming in dozens of dessert-style flavors like chocolate, vanilla, cookies, and salted caramel.
Mixing technique makes or breaks the hemp experience when preparing protein shakes with hemp powder. The earthy notes practically disappear when you blend the powder with banana, cocoa, nut butter, dates, or mixed berries in a smoothie. Shaking it with water alone is the single biggest reason new buyers abandon hemp after the first tub.
Price tells a similar story. Hemp protein typically costs two to three times more per gram of protein than whey powder because hemp seeds are a low-yield agricultural raw material, whereas whey is an inexpensive byproduct of cheese production. Smaller market scale and lower protein density per pound widen the gap further.
Availability also favors whey, which sits on virtually every grocery and supplement store shelf. Hemp protein still leans on health-food retailers and online suppliers, though distribution keeps expanding as plant-based demand grows through 2026.

Hemp Protein vs Whey Protein: FAQ
Is Hemp Protein Healthier Than Whey Protein?
It depends on what you’re optimizing for. Hemp protein delivers more fiber, omega-3 ALA, magnesium, iron, and zinc, which support gut health and whole-food nutrition. Whey protein offers higher protein density, more BCAAs, and stronger clinical research on blood pressure and glucose control.
For gut health and plant-based diets, hemp is the healthier pick. For muscle retention, recovery, and protein efficiency per calorie, whey takes the edge.
Is Hemp Protein or Whey Protein Better for Muscle Building?
Whey wins based on current evidence for maximizing muscle growth. It delivers roughly 2.5–3 g of leucine per scoop, absorbs within 20–40 minutes, and scores higher on PDCAAS and DIAAS, with decades of hypertrophy research behind it.
Hemp can still support muscle maintenance if daily intake reaches 1.6–2.2 g/kg of bodyweight, though it is not optimal optimal for maximizing hypertrophy.
Can You Build Muscle With Hemp Protein?
Yes, because hypertrophy depends on total daily protein intake and resistance training, not a single powder.
The practical caveat: hemp’s lower protein density means you’ll need a larger 40–50 g serving, or you can pair it with pea or rice protein to close the leucine and lysine gap per scoop.
Hemp Protein vs Whey Isolate: Which Has More Protein per Scoop?
Whey isolate delivers around 25–27 g of protein per 30 g scoop, reaching 85–90% protein density. Hemp protein powder provides roughly 10–15 g per 30 g scoop, sitting at 30–50% density. That two-fold gap is the main reason whey isolate remains the cheapest option per gram of protein on the market.
Why Does Hemp Protein Cost More Than Whey?
Whey is a near-free byproduct of cheese manufacturing, while hemp seeds are a low-yield crop requiring cold-pressing and specialized milling. Smaller market scale and lower protein density per pound push prices higher.
